"C" is for corpse
(Audio CD)
Bobby Callahan was only 20 when an accident left him disfigured for life. Doctors patched up his body, but couldn't fix his mind. Chunks of his memory were lost but he knew that someone had tried to kill him and that the "accident" was deliberate. No one believed him so he hired Kinsey Millhone. Three days later Bobby was dead, but Kinsey never welshed on a deal. She'd been hired to stop a killing, now she'd find the killer instead...
